For far more than two a long time, Naomi Brown’s 11 little ones had watched as her property sat in foreclosures.
Theodis Jones: “With sleepless nights, it’s been tough on me. Depressed. It’s been really hard.”
Tough mainly because his mother still left the household to Theodis, and he was the just one who was shedding it.
Theodis Jones: “My ex-girlfriend went behind my back and took two loans off of this household without having my awareness of it.”
Permit’s back up to 2021, when Theodis’ ex, Adrienne McSweeney, went to a personal financial institution to borrow $120,000 using Theodis’ house as collateral.
She was accused of pulling it off by thieving Theodis’ driver’s license and obtaining this guy to fake to be Theodis.
Theodis Jones: “The photograph didn’t match.”
A handful of months later on, the lender commenced to foreclose on the dwelling.
Theodis Jones: “It’s been a crime fully commited from me and the individuals attempting to get my house.”
When Theodis contacted McSweeney and advised her he was contacting the police, she texted again, “All I inquire is time to correct it. Less than 8 weeks.”
Patrick Fraser: “So you are going to get rid of your mama’s home?”
Theodis Jones: “I don’t want to reduce it, not if you can enable me.”
Mark Mastrarrigo then stepped in to characterize Theodis.
He had the shots from the closing, but most importantly, a handwriting skilled.
This is the impostor’s signature. This is Theodis’.
Mark Mastrarrigo: “And she gave us her best of greatest variability. That is not Theodis’ signature.”
Mark had financial institution statements that confirmed McSweeney received the dollars. But the lender explained to me they were being persuaded Theodis and McSweeney worked collectively.
Yet another yr passed. Then, immediately after a deposition with Theodis, the lawyer for the title coverage enterprise was persuaded Theodis was the sufferer. They paid the financial institution the $120,000 again, and the foreclosure against Theodis was dismissed.
Mark Mastrarrigo: “We received, but he won. His dwelling was at stake.”
Mark handed the decide’s purchase to Theodis. His property was free of charge and very clear yet again.
Theodis Jones: “I can’t even consider detailing how I sense ideal now. It’s a blessing.”
It was a prolonged battle that took a very good decided law firm to help save Theodis.
Patrick Fraser: “Theodis couldn’t have carried out this on its individual, could he?”
Mark Mastrarrigo: “Completely not, and if you don’t have any person on your facet that understands what they’re carrying out, that’s going to do the suitable issue, chances are you’re going to get a terrible outcome.”
The decide also purchased the title insurance coverage enterprise to pay Theodis’ authorized service fees. Another victory for him.
Theodis Jones: “I thank everyone — I thank you, I thank Howard, I thank my lawyer Mark, my household. It’s been true rough, gentleman, two a long time and 4 months.”
Talking of successful, recall Karen Dematas, who hired a credit card debt aid enterprise?
Karen Dematas: “I’ve read about financial debt reduction businesses, and I just imagined that it was very good.”
She had an $11,000 credit card invoice. CDS credit card debt relief told her they would get the debt wiped out if she paid out them $199 a thirty day period. She did.
Karen Dematas: ‘And I would be financial debt absolutely free in a 12 months, a 12 months and a 50 percent. That’s what they told me.”
For 6 months, Karen paid out them, then found out they didn’t get her debt reduced at all.
She questioned us to get her $1,200 again. But we identified the firm closed a single workplace in West Palm Seaside, then another, and the registered proprietor didn’t return my dozen cellphone phone calls.
Patrick Fraser: “I tried. I could not get them to give the dollars back again.”
Karen Dematas: “I understand, I fully grasp. It’s sad, but I comprehend.”
Our tale aired. And then…
Karen Dematas: “He sent a few payments via Zelle: a single $500, one particular $500 and then $200.”
The financial debt aid company returned Karen’s $1,200.
Karen Dematas: “Since Channel 7 confirmed and built the report on him, and I guess he felt guilty.”
A nice, unpredicted shock.
Karen Dematas: “I was really stunned. I was seriously stunned.”
A excellent shock, but Karen even now has that massive credit score card financial debt and no way to pay it.
As for the female accused of having $120,000 in Theodis’ situation, Miami-Dade Law enforcement are nonetheless investigating, but they haven’t charged her with nearly anything.
